The POLESTAR Electric Trailer Jack is a robust and reliable option for anyone needing to lift and stabilize heavy trailers, boats, RVs, or off-road vehicles. With a weight capacity of 5000 lbs, it is quite capable of handling most heavy-duty tasks. The lift height ranges from 9 inches to 27 inches, with an additional 4.5-inch drop leg, offering a total lift height of up to 31.5 inches, which is versatile enough for different trailer types and scenarios. This makes it particularly useful for uneven terrains and various parking situations.
The advanced ball screw design ensures smooth and efficient operation, reducing friction and wear for better performance compared to traditional jacks. This design, combined with a powerful brake motor, ensures consistent and stable lifting, enhancing ease of use. The POLESTAR jack is crafted from durable, weather-resistant materials, allowing it to withstand harsh outdoor conditions, including rain, snow, and sun exposure. This durability is complemented by a built-in circuit breaker for added safety.
One of its standout features is the integrated LED light, which provides illumination where it's most needed, making nighttime operations easier. The jack is also praised for its ease of installation and high reliability, backed by a one-year warranty and responsive customer service. However, some potential drawbacks include its weight of 23.1 pounds, which might be a bit cumbersome for some users, and the need for hard wiring to a 12V DC power source, which could complicate installation for those not familiar with electrical setups. Despite these minor issues, the POLESTAR Electric Trailer Jack is a reliable and efficient choice for both professionals and DIY enthusiasts looking for a durable and high-performing trailer jack.
The VEVOR 2000 lbs Trailer Jack with Dual Wheel is a robust and versatile option for those seeking a reliable boat trailer jack. With an impressive load capacity of 2000 pounds, it is well-suited for various types of trailers, including travel trailers, horse trailers, and multi-purpose trailers. The lifting range of 12.51 to 22.52 inches ensures that it can handle both high-profile and low-profile trailers, providing flexibility in use.
The dual-wheel design, featuring PP tires, offers enhanced stability and smooth movement, even on challenging terrains like mud, gravel, and wet surfaces. The tires are designed to resist sinking and getting stuck, which is a significant advantage. The trailer jack’s construction from heavy-duty carbon steel with a galvanized and powder-coated finish ensures durability and corrosion resistance, making it a long-lasting investment.
The swivel function and bolt-on or weld-on mounting style add to its ease of use, allowing for simple installation and maneuverability. Additionally, the detachable handle for manual operation provides convenience in power outage or emergency situations. However, the product does have some drawbacks. Weighing 20.9 pounds, it might be a bit heavy for some users to handle alone. Its substantial size (35.3 inches in length) may also be cumbersome for storage or transport if space is limited. Despite these minor inconveniences, the VEVOR trailer jack's strengths, such as load capacity, ease of installation, and durability, make it a valuable tool for anyone in need of a reliable boat trailer jack.
The KYX Electric Trailer Jack is designed to handle heavy loads with a high capacity of 7,500 pounds, making it suitable for large trailers and RVs. It offers flexible mounting options, allowing installation on the side or insertion into the support hole, providing convenience depending on your trailer setup. The built-in LED lights enhance safety for use in low-light conditions.
Constructed from high carbon steel with a rust-proof coating and waterproof features, it is built to withstand weather and outdoor exposure, which is important for trailers. The electric operation simplifies raising and lowering your trailer, while the manual crank backup ensures operation can continue if the power supply runs out. Height adjustability helps keep your trailer level on various surfaces, improving ease of use and stability.
Weighing about 30.8 pounds, it could be somewhat heavy for frequent handling by one person. This jack is a reliable, heavy-duty electric jack suitable for RVs or large trailers, especially for those who prioritize durability, safety in low light, and the assurance of a manual backup option.
